What is a deprecated add-on?

Sooner or later, modules end their life cycle and are taken off the market. However, that does not mean that these add-ons have poor functionality. It’s quite often when an unpopular plugin is well-designed and feature-rich, but for some reason has not made its way to a consumer on a mass market. Or, alternatively, it was so popular that the CS-Cart original platform developer decided to include a part of its functionality into the default package. Such modules are rare, so you shouldn’t write them off. Let’s mention just a few of them:

  • Form Logs: logs the date and time of the Contact Us form, the user IP, and other form contents to keep all requests made via the Contact us form in your store.
  • Bambora Payment Gateway: a Canada-based payment processor that allows you to accept credit card payments in your online store without redirecting the user to the payment gateway.
  • Moneris Payment Gateway: Canada’s largest processor and acquirer of debit and credit card payments for North American and Canadian merchants.
  • ANZ eGate Payment Gateway:  a safe and convenient way of accepting card payments online with detailed payment reports
  • AsiaPay Payment Gateway: supports many payment methods, including VISA, MasterCard, American Express, JCB, Diners Club Card, PPS, China UnionPay, AliPay, 99Bill, TenPay, PayPal and other Asia debit payments.

Why are addons withdrawn from sale?

The most common reasons are that their functionality has lost its relevance for a majority of customers or it has been partially included in the default CS-Cart functionality.
